Jollibee, girl group Katseye launch partnership for North American fans

Jollibee has launched a partnership with girl group Katseye. Jollibee, known for its Chickenjoy fried chicken and welcoming service, has created a loyal fan base across generations and cultures. Katseye is bringing together families and communities with their growing Eyekons fan group, according to a press release.

Jollibee began as an ice cream parlor in the Philippines to a global QSR name.

The partnership kicked off with a merchandise drop on Aug. 15 by media brand Complex and includes:

  • Shared Dream Tank Top.
  • Chickenjoy Gnarly Box Tee.
  • Double Drop Denim Tote.

"Jollibee always strives to bring people together through the universal language of delicious food and shared moments of joy," Luis Velasco, SVP and marketing head at Jollibee North America, said in the press release. "This is precisely why partnering with Katseye, a group that deeply resonates with a diverse, global audience and embodies such positive energy, is a perfect match for our beloved brand. Their passion and vibrant spirit align seamlessly with our distinctive heritage of fostering community and happiness. We're incredibly excited to join forces with such a talented group of women and create unforgettable experiences for our fans."

Katseye plans to roll out additional menu items and limited-edition collectibles in the future.

Jollibee is part of Jollibee Foods Corp., which has more than 10,000 stores and cafes across 33 states.
